Rockabilly Pioneers Took Familiar Musical Forms and Developed a Genre All Their OwnThe post World War II years in America saw an explosion of musical art. The war was over, the boys had come home, and the production prowess of the nation shifted away from the war machine back to the consumer goods that it had originally been set up to pump out. Many of our musician soldiers too returned to their vocation of creating music. Country music, jazz, swing, and other forms of popular music didn’t just pick up where they left off, they began thriving and moving in new directions as musicians experimented with musical influences they might have picked up overseas and a new musical freedom that availed itself along with the freedom from war that the country had been longing for. From this new expression, rockabilly sprouted and grew at a phenomenal pace until it was the hottest form of music around.
Before “Oh Pretty Woman” Roy Orbison Contributed to The Rockabilly SceneAlmost every fan of rock and roll knows the name Roy Orbison. His song “Pretty Woman” has become a classic and has been covered by many artists over the years. He’s also known for his beautiful, smooth, and soaring voice which he used to such great effect on countless rock ballads like “Only the Lonely” which reached #2 on the charts and “Running Scared” which made it all the way to the top spot in 1960. But before he was recording these wonderful rock ballads, laced with string arrangements to compliment Orbison’s amazing voice, he was recording rockabilly.

Few Rockabilly Stars Became Household Names, But That Doesn’t Mean They Didn’t Rock!There are several rockabilly artists from the 1950s when rockabilly originally hit the scene that have since become household names. These are artists that pretty much everyone has heard of. Among these names are Elvis Presley, Johnny Cash, Roy Orbison, Jerry Lee Lewis, and Conway Twitty (who was recording back then as Harold Jenkins). But there are other rockabilly cats who had a huge impact on the world of rock and roll but whose names most people wouldn’t recognize, even though they’re probably familiar with some of their music from listening to “oldies.” Then of course, there are the completely obscure rockabilly artists whose songs never survived to make it onto oldies radio shows and whose names are all but lost to rock and roll history. Yet the music that these musicians made proves the value of their contributions to rock and roll.
